Transaction 521bd3007cd21d05ec2cf3adbe02674507136903c58fa5aaace0e3af2fb18856
1 Input
1 Output
-
521bd3007cd21d05ec2cf3adbe02674507136903c58fa5aaace0e3af2fb18856:0
- value
- 532798
- script pubkey
- OP_0 OP_PUSHBYTES_20 52e9950a4ce52eb82131798cb4d2bf9bb758c5e9
- address
- bc1q2t5e2zjvu5htsgf30xxtf54lnwm4330flw7fxd